Dive headfirst into the exhilarating world of motorsport with Project CARS 3, a racing simulator that seamlessly blends realism with accessibility. Developed by Slightly Mad Studios and published by Bandai Namco Entertainment, this title throws you behind the wheel of an impressive array of vehicles, ranging from iconic street cars to cutting-edge prototypes, each meticulously crafted for authentic handling and performance.

Project CARS 3 distinguishes itself from its predecessors by prioritizing a more arcade-like experience while retaining a solid foundation in simulation. This balancing act allows both seasoned sim racers and newcomers to the genre to enjoy intense wheel-to-wheel action without sacrificing immersion.

A World of Speed Awaits: Exploring Project CARS 3’s Tracks and Modes

The game boasts an extensive roster of tracks, spanning iconic circuits like Monza and Silverstone to fictional speedways designed to push both driver and car to their limits. From tight street courses demanding precision cornering to high-speed ovals rewarding sheer bravery, Project CARS 3 offers a diverse playground for motorsport enthusiasts.

Track Type Examples Description
Road Courses Silverstone Circuit, Hockenheimring, Nürburgring Nordschleife Winding layouts with challenging corners and elevation changes.
Oval Tracks Indianapolis Motor Speedway, Daytona International Speedway High-banking ovals emphasizing raw speed and drafting techniques.
Street Circuits Monaco, Brands Hatch GP Tight, unforgiving tracks weaving through urban environments.

Beyond traditional racing modes, Project CARS 3 introduces a refined career system that guides you from aspiring kart racer to Formula E champion. Earn experience points, unlock new vehicles and upgrades, and compete in a variety of championships designed to test your skills and adaptability.

Buckling Up for the Challenge: Potential Downsides

While Project CARS 3 excels in many areas, it is not without its shortcomings. Some players may find the AI opponents somewhat predictable, and the career mode could benefit from a more engaging narrative structure.

  • Predictable AI: The game’s artificial intelligence can sometimes feel repetitive and lack the dynamism found in other racing simulators.

  • Limited Narrative Depth: While the career mode provides a framework for progression, it lacks a compelling story or character development to truly invest players in their virtual journey.
